cocos creator回调函数怎么用

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了cocos creator回调函数怎么用相关的知识,希望对你有一定的参考价值。

参考技术A onLoad 回调会在这个组件所在的场景被载入 的时候触发,在 onLoad 阶段,保证了你可以获取到场景中的其他节点,以及节点关联的资源数据。本回答被提问者采纳

cocos creator怎么获取触摸点坐标

setInputControl: function ()
//add keyboard input listener to jump, turnLeft and turnRight
cc.eventManager.addListener(
event: cc.EventListener.TOUCH_ONE_BY_ONE,
onTouchBegan: function (touches, event)
console.log('Touch Began: ' + event + getLocationX);
return true;
,
onTouchMoved: function (touches, event)
console.log('Touch Moved: ' + event);
,
onTouchEnded: function (touches, event)
console.log('Touch Ended: ' + event);

, this.node);
,
这样可以在触摸的时候在控制台上打印出字,那怎么在打印那里输入触点坐标呢

参考技术A 你弄复杂了
this.node.on('touchstart',function(event)
var pos = event.getLocation();
,this);

这样就会得到触点坐标,后续可以再转化为游戏内坐标

以上是关于cocos creator回调函数怎么用的主要内容,如果未能解决你的问题,请参考以下文章

cocos2dx 怎么在schedule的回调函数中加参数

Cocos Creator 入门

将参数传递给回调函数COCOS2D Android

Cocos2d-x 3.0 基础系列一 各类回调函数写法汇总

Cocos2d-x 3.0 基础系列一 各类回调函数写法汇总

Cocos2d-x 3.0中 物理碰撞检測中onContactBegin回调函数不响应问题